<i>POU6F2</i> mutation identified in humans with pubertal failure shifts isoform formation and alters GnRH transcript expression
2022-10-16
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Idiopathic hypogonadotropic hypogonadism (IHH) is characterized by absent pubertal development and infertility, often due to g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H) deficits. Exome sequencing of two independent cohorts of IHH patients identified 12 rare missense variants in POU6F2. POU6F2 encodes two distinct isoforms.
